7. PERT
Te(expected time)= (O +4M + P)/6 where O=optimistic time, M= most likely time,
P=pessimistic time.
V(variance)=( (P-O)/6)^2
Project variance= sum of variances along the critical path
Standard deviation = sq root of variance

11. Forecasting Population

 Arithmatic method

dP/dt = Ka
P = P1 + Ka (t - t1)
P = population
t = time
Ka = arithmetic growth constant
 Geometric method
dP/dt= KgP
lnP = lnP1 + Kg (t - t1)
Kg =lnP2-lnP1/t2-t1 = ln[P2/P1]/t2-t1
P = population
t = time
Kg = geometric growth constant
